Sciweavers

1140 search results - page 4 / 228
» Embedded Software: Better Models, Better Code
Sort
View
CODES
2000
IEEE
13 years 10 months ago
Compaan: deriving process networks from Matlab for embedded signal processing architectures
This paperpresents the Compaantool that automatically transforms a nestedloopprogram written in Matlab into a processnetwork speciļ¬cation. The processnetworkmodelof computationļ...
Bart Kienhuis, Edwin Rijpkema, Ed F. Deprettere
TPHOL
2009
IEEE
14 years 13 days ago
A Better x86 Memory Model: x86-TSO
Abstract. Real multiprocessors do not provide the sequentially consistent memory that is assumed by most work on semantics and veriļ¬cation. Instead, they have relaxed memory mode...
Scott Owens, Susmit Sarkar, Peter Sewell
SEFM
2009
IEEE
14 years 16 days ago
Adjusted Verification Rules for Loops Are More Complete and Give Better Diagnostics for Less
ā€”Increasingly, tools and their underlying theories are able to cope with ā€œreal codeā€ written as part of industrial grade applications almost as is. It has been our experience...
Patrice Chalin
CODES
1997
IEEE
13 years 10 months ago
Software Architecture Synthesis for Retargetable Real-time Embedded Systems
ā€“ Retargetability of embedded system descriptions not only enables better exploration of the design space and evaluation of cost/performance tradeoffs but also enhances design ma...
Pai H. Chou, Gaetano Borriello
CODES
2008
IEEE
14 years 8 days ago
Scratchpad allocation for concurrent embedded software
Software-controlled scratchpad memory is increasingly employed in embedded systems as it offers better timing predictability compared to caches. Previous scratchpad allocation alg...
Vivy Suhendra, Abhik Roychoudhury, Tulika Mitra